The 456th at Castle attended William Tell 1961 with their brand new FY59 birds, including the squadron boss, Lt Col Price, who flew this bird. This is the earliest known instance of a standard UHF blade antenna (retro) fitted under the nose, replacing the worthless factory installation inside the fin cap. Note that the command stripes actually cover part of the intake lip.
